This week's cabinet reshuffle posed plenty of big questions. What are the implications of Therese Coffey's departure from DEFRA? Who exactly is Steve Barclay? How many housing ministers have we had since 2010? Listen to the ENDS Report team discuss these issues - and much more - in this latest podcast episode.Every week, the ENDS team enters the ECO Chamber to discuss the UK’s biggest green news stories, as well as taking a forensic look at one of the deep-rooted environmental issues facing us today.In this week's episode we:Unpack the latest cabinet reshuffle, which saw environment secretary Thérèse Coffey out and Steve Barclay inShare news of former Environment Agency interim chief executive John Curtin’s abrupt departureAnd take a look at how Cardiff Council workers ended up in jail after a scandal involving a waste siteFor the deep dive, we speak to ENDS Report news editor Pippa Neill who got the inside scoop on how the National Farmers Union lobbied DEFRA to lower its global air quality ambitions on a dangerous pollutant – ammonia.
